- 144
- 0
- 约6.89千字
- 约 12页
- 2017-05-13 发布于湖北
- 举报
嵌入式系统流水灯按键定时器实验报告解读
嵌入式系统应用
实验报告
姓 名: 学 号: 学 院: 专 业: 班 级: 指导教师:
实验1、流水灯实验
1.1实验要求
编程控制实验板上LED灯轮流点亮、熄灭,中间间隔一定时间。
1.2原理分析
实验主要考察对STM32F10X系列单片机GPIO的输出操作。
参阅数据手册可知,通过软件编程,GPIO可以配置成以下几种模式:
◇输入浮空
◇输入上拉
◇输入下拉
◇模拟输入
◇开漏输出
◇推挽式输出
◇推挽式复用功能
◇开漏式复用功能
根据实验要求,应该首先将GPIO配置为推挽输出模式。
由原理图可知,单片机GPIO输出信号经过74HC244缓冲器,连接LED灯。由于74HC244的OE1和OE2都接地,为相同电平,故A端电平与Y端电平相同且LED灯共阳,所以,如果要点亮LED,GPIO应输出低电平。反之,LED灯熄灭。
1.3程序分析
软件方面,在程序启动时,调用SystemInit()函数(见附录1),对系统时钟等关键部分进行初始化,然后再对GPIO进行配置。
GPIO配置函数为SZ_STM32_LEDInit()(见附录2),函数中首先使能GPIO时钟:
RCC_APB2PeriphClockCmd(GPIO_CLK[Led], ENABLE);
然后配置GPIO输入输出模式:
GPIO_InitStructure.G
您可能关注的文档
- 山东省胜利七中学八级语文上学期期末考试试题人教新课标要点.doc
- 山东省继续医学教育公共课程考试答案要点.docx
- 山东省莱芜市高三上学期期末考试文综试卷要点.doc
- 山东省郯城第三中学七级历史上册《昌盛的秦汉文化》(新人教)要点.ppt
- 山东省青岛市中高三上学期期中考试生物试题Word含答案要点.doc
- 山东省青岛市中高三生物上学期期中试题要点.doc
- 山东省青岛市高三下学期高考诊断性测试(一模)文综(B卷)要点.doc
- 山东省高三下学期综合测试理综试卷要点.doc
- 山东省高三冲刺模拟(五)文科综合要点.doc
- 山东省高三冲刺模拟(二)理科综合试题要点.doc
- 2026安徽长江产权交易所及下属子企业招聘工作人员4人笔试历年参考题库附带答案详解.docx
- 2026年新材料在航空航天领域的应用现状与未来趋势报告.docx
- 2026年短视频内容创作行业现状与发展趋势报告.docx
- 2026安徽马鞍山蓝黛传动机械校园招聘45人笔试历年参考题库附带答案详解.docx
- 2026年新能源行业县域市场品牌渗透策略分析报告.docx
- 2026安徽马鞍山市富嘉益新能源科技有限公司招聘15人笔试历年参考题库附带答案详解.docx
- 2026年城市周边游市场潜力研究报告.docx
- 2026安徽马鞍山首创水务有限责任公司招聘劳务人员增加笔试环节笔试历年参考题库附带答案详解.docx
- 2026年智能网联汽车智能驾驶辅助系统创新报告.docx
- 2026年智能机器人养老应用报告.docx
最近下载
- 南京六合BRW400-315/31.5乳化液泵使用说明书.pdf VIP
- 混合动力城市客车车身骨架设计-课程设计论文.doc VIP
- 企业价值评估中收益法的理论与实践探究:基于多案例分析.docx VIP
- 城市客车车身骨架设计及模态分析分析.pdf VIP
- SAE_J1742_1998电线束高压连接.pdf VIP
- TigerTouch老虎控台教程详解.pdf
- Unit 7 A Good Read课时4 Section B 1a-1e(教学评教学设计)英语新教材人教版八年级下册.docx
- 欧洲规范-NF P94-093-中文版.pdf VIP
- 医院检验科网络应急预案.docx VIP
- 环境监测采样培训课件.pptx VIP
原创力文档

文档评论(0)